In the intricately woven fabric of country music, Luke Combs' "Every Little Bit Helps" stands as a testament to the resilient human spirit and the power of incremental progress. This poignant composition tells a tale of moving on from heartache, one small step at a time.

The narrative unfolds in a series of vignettes that paint a picture of an individual's quest for personal growth and healing after a relationship's end. Each line describes how seemingly insignificant actions can contribute to the process of leaving the past behind: "This futon I crashed on in college, well it ain't our bed…but at least it don't smell like you."

The song's themes revolve around healing and the power of incremental progress. The protagonist takes small steps to distance himself from his ex-love, finding solace in mundane activities such as putting on a record or drinking a beer with friends. Each action serves as a reminder that progress, no matter how small, is still progress.

The lyrics of "Every Little Bit Helps" are an ode to the power of perseverance in the face of heartache. The protagonist recognizes that every little action he takes, be it as simple as listening to a record or drinking a beer with friends, moves him closer to leaving his past behind and beginning anew. These seemingly insignificant steps serve as building blocks that help him heal and grow.

The universal appeal of "Every Little Bit Helps" lies in its ability to resonate with anyone who has experienced heartbreak. The song's narrative of taking small steps toward healing is relatable and provides hope for those still grappling with the aftermath of a relationship's end. Through the protagonist's journey, listeners are encouraged to embrace the idea that every little bit counts when it comes to moving on and finding peace.

Combs' poetic brilliance shines through in the vivid imagery he uses to convey the protagonist's emotions and growth. For instance, the line "Step by step, I'm gettin' out from under that spell you put on me" is a powerful metaphor for the protagonist's determination to free himself from the emotional hold his ex-love had over him. The reference to stepping out of the "valley of the shadow of death" adds depth to the song, highlighting the intensity and complexity of heartache.

In "Every Little Bit Helps," Luke Combs has crafted a beautiful tribute to the human spirit's ability to heal and grow from heartache. The narrative of taking small steps toward progress is both relatable and inspiring, offering listeners hope that they too can overcome their past and find peace in the present. The song's poetic brilliance and vivid imagery make for a captivating listening experience, ensuring that "Every Little Bit Helps" remains a beloved addition to country music's rich tapestry.
